The Lexington (MA) Bicentennial Band presents its annual winter
concert on Sunday, January 23rd, 2005, at 2 pm at the Donald J.
Gillespie Auditorium at Lexington High School. Music Director Jeffrey
Leonard will lead the band in the following program:
The Circus Bee - Henry Fillmore
An Original Suite for Military Band - Gordon Jacob
Pavanne - Morton Gould
Scenes from the Louvre - Norman Dello Joio
Masque - W. Francis MacBeth
Dance Bacchanale from "Samson and Delilah" - Camille Saint-Saens, arr.
Jay Bocook
Tocatta - Girolamo Frescobaldi, arr. Earl Slocum
Swing Low, Sweet Chariot - arr. Steve Rouse
Selections from "Aladdin" - Alan Menken, arr. John Moss
The Silver Quill - Dale Harpham and Sammy Nestico
Admission is free, and donations will be gratefully accepted.
